ABNB ANNOUNCES NEW ASSISTANT VICE PRESIDENT AND NEW DIRECTORS

ABNB Federal Credit Union is proud to announce several internal staff promotions and new hires effective immediately.  

Michelle Perry has been promoted to Assistant Vice-President of Consumer Lending. Perry will oversee Consumer Lending, Card Services, Central Files, Collections, and the Loan Center which includes Direct and Indirect Consumer Lending. Perry came to ABNB four years ago with 33 years of experience in the credit union industry overseeing multiple departments in various leadership roles. She has achieved record lending performance while seeing charge-offs gradually decline under her guidance.

Melissa Rose has been promoted to Director of Marketing and has been with ABNB more than seven years in various leadership roles at the credit union. Rose has been the lead project liaison from the Marketing department for major credit union wide projects including the launch of the intranet, Field of Membership expansion, website redesign plus debit and credit card conversions. She has 15 years with a focus in corporate partnerships and regional brand strategies utilizing award winning marketing best practices.

Cassandra Tucker has been promoted to Director of Operations and will continue to oversee the Operations department and the performance of payment channels (ACH, Wire, Share Draft, RTP/FedNow) in addition to deposit products, retail and commercial products, and merchant services. Tucker brings more than 13 years of managerial experience in the financial services industry overseeing multiple departments in various leadership roles.

Stacy Blausey has been promoted to Director of Compliance and will continue to oversee all aspects of the credit union’s compliance activities including changes in laws and regulations, information disclosures, reviewing product/service marketing materials, managing ABNB’s compliance management system, along with oversight for all aspects of the Bank Secrecy Act.  Blausey brings more than 29 years of experience in various leadership roles in the financial industry and has been with ABNB for 13 years.

Shawn Hayes has been promoted to Director of Enterprise Risk & Information Security Officer and will oversee Enterprise Risk Management, Information Security and Fraud.  Shawn joined ABNB six years ago with 19 years of Information Technology experience to lead the Information Security and Networking Teams.  As the credit union’s Information Security Officer, he worked directly with the Vice President of Risk Management and has been member of ABNB’s Enterprise Risk Management Committee since its formation.

Tyler Foley has been hired as the Director of Business Intelligence and will oversee data strategy, analytics, and the cultivation of a culture centered around data-driven decision-making. He brings a passion for innovation, along with over a decade of experience in Business Analytics and Intelligence, spanning diverse business sectors including Government, Education, and Technology. Prior to joining ABNB, Tyler held high-level managerial positions at the Virginia Department of Transportation, InMotion Hosting, and ExecOnline.
